Octahedron
represents a regular octahedron centered at the origin with unit edge length.
Octahedron[l]
represents an octahedron with edge length l.
Octahedron[{θ,ϕ},…]
represents an octahedron rotated by an angle θ with respect to the z axis and angle ϕ with respect to the y axis.
Octahedron[{x,y,z},…]
represents an octahedron centered at {x,y,z}.
Details and Options

- Octahedron is also known as regular octahedron.
- Octahedron can be used as a geometric region and graphics primitive.
- Octahedron[] is equivalent to Octahedron[{0,0,0},1].
- Octahedron[l] is equivalent to Octahedron[{0,0,0},l].
- CanonicalizePolyhedron can be used to convert a octahedron to an explicit Polyhedron object.
- Octahedron can be used in Graphics3D.
- In graphics, the points and edge lengths can be Scaled and Dynamic expressions.
- Graphics rendering is affected by directives such as FaceForm, EdgeForm, Opacity, Texture and color.
- The following options and settings can be used in graphics:
